Simon Vector is one of the League's Flagship properties. Simon Vector is a sci-fi thriller based on the characters created by Johnny Atomic with the screenplay penned by Adam-Troy Castro (Emissaries From the Dead).
SV&DKM takes place on the Terran Empire's farthest outpost, a lonely terra-forming colony called Majesty. When an unexplainable and unstoppable series of murders plunge the colony into panic only Simon Vector, the most hated man in the galaxy, can save them. The problem is, he is already dead.
Simon Vector is a multi-platform property that is suitable for film, tv, novels and videogames.
The Turning Lands is the story of Adam, youngest member of a family of theatrical illusionists who discovers he is a real sorcerer. Called from across the dimensions to The Turning Lands, he must learn to use his powers to save an entire world or die a terrible death at the hands of the evil and horribly mutated Ascended Ones.
The Turning Lands was produced by League Entertainment and is based on the characters created by The Xcentrix. Written by Best-Selling Fantasy Author, Richard Lee Byers and Art by Johnny Atomic, The Turning Lands is a Fantasy adventure created for the Tween and Young Adult Audience.
Paperback (6X9), approximately 225 pages.
The Adventures of Captain Horatio Stytch is the story of an epic quest across a world of living toys. Stytch, a stuffed bear, was his country’s hero in a vicious new kind of war. Asked to fight again, he risks being thought a coward by refusing. However, in order to find the source of this new evil and defeat it, Stytch must embark on an adventure to find the fabled Toymaker's Workshop.
Stytch is a multi-platform property targeting the children's and tween markets.
A darkness has fallen on the land. A curse compounded of vengeance and hate, of plague and black magic has laid siege to a small kingdom. Hell is coming, and only one young knight stands in its way.
Based on the short story “The Plague Knight” by Richard Lee Byers, League Entertainment has expanded on the 1980 short story, laying the foundation for a horror/fantasy trilogy based on Byers' Martin Rivers character. Plague Knight is a multi-platform property suitable for film, tv, novels and comic books.
Vile is a compilation of short stories based on villains of the Bible. With paintings by Johnny Atomic and stories by some of the country's best fiction writers, League Entertainment is breathing new life into these fantastic stories.
With an anticipated young adult and adult audience, Vile will be marketed to both spiritual and traditional booksellers.
Paintings by Johnny Atomic.
Matt Brown’s world has plenty of monsters and super-heroes, but he‘s not one of them. He lives an ordinary life in Jackson City until wasp-like aliens called the Shenn attack Earth. Whether he likes it or not, greatness has been thrust upon him and Matt must use all of his knowledge and experience, along with a few spare supersuits, to fend off the city's villains while also trying to save Earth from the Shenn. Heir Apparent is a comical look at what happens when a slacker is mankind’s last hope.
Heir Apparent is a multi-platform property targeted toward the tween and young adult audiences. Can you escape Jack? Ripperopoly is a turn-based board game developed by League Entertainment. Dare to survive until dawn as you compete with other players to purchase historic properties along the dangerous streets and alleys of Whitechapel. Complete with standard play and quick play rules, Ripperoply is perfect for anyone interested in the unsolved Ripper murders.
